The Evolution of AI Viral Video Generators

The AI video generation market has undergone significant transformation by 2026, moving beyond generic content creation to specialized viral templates. According to Trend Hunter, 78% of successful short-form videos now use some form of AI-assisted editing or templating system. This shift reflects both technological advancements and changing creator needs in the competitive social media landscape.

Platforms that dominated in earlier years have either adapted or disappeared entirely. The discontinuation of OpenAI's Sora in March 2026, as reported by AP News, demonstrated how ethical concerns can rapidly alter the market. Meanwhile, tools like AI Inspo gained traction by focusing on specific use cases rather than offering overly broad generation capabilities.

The current generation of AI viral video generators emphasizes three key aspects: platform-specific optimization (TikTok, Reels, YouTube Shorts), template libraries for trending content formats, and built-in analytics to predict virality potential. This trifecta addresses creators' need for both creative tools and strategic guidance in an increasingly algorithm-driven content ecosystem.

Key Features That Define 2026's Best Generators

The leading AI viral video generators share several distinguishing characteristics that set them apart from earlier-generation tools:

Template Intelligence Systems

Modern platforms go beyond static templates, incorporating real-time trend data to suggest adjustments. Revid AI's "Dynamic Template" system, for example, can modify text placement, clip duration, and even color schemes based on current platform algorithm preferences. This represents a shift from creators adapting to templates, to templates adapting to creators.

Cross-Platform Optimization

With content repurposing becoming essential, top generators now include automatic reformatting. A video created for TikTok gets intelligently reconfigured for Reels and YouTube Shorts, with adjusted aspect ratios, caption positioning, and even clip sequencing. AI Inspo's June 2026 update reduced cross-platform reformatting time by 72% according to internal benchmarks.

Ethical Content Safeguards

Following the Sora controversy, all major platforms now implement verification systems. These include watermarking, content provenance tracking, and "deepfake detection" filters that flag potentially misleading manipulations. The most sophisticated systems like World Cup AI Templates even maintain databases of licensed player likenesses to prevent unauthorized impersonations.

How AI Viral Video Generators Are Changing Content Creation

The impact of these tools extends far beyond simple video production, fundamentally altering the creator economy in three significant ways:

First, they've dramatically lowered the barrier to entry for high-quality content. Where professional editing skills were once mandatory for viral success, AI generators now enable novice creators to produce polished videos in minutes. This democratization has led to a 210% increase in first-time viral creators since 2025 according to Trend Hunter analytics.

Second, the tools have shifted creative focus from technical execution to strategic ideation. Creators spend less time on clip trimming and color correction, and more time developing unique angles on trending topics. This evolution mirrors the photography world's shift from film development to digital composition.

Third, AI generators are creating new content categories altogether. The rise of "template remix" culture sees creators combining elements from multiple AI templates to produce hybrid formats. Platforms now track these remixes as distinct trend patterns, with the most successful combinations being incorporated back into official template libraries.

Ethical Considerations and Industry Response

The rapid advancement of AI video generation hasn't been without controversy, leading to significant industry developments:

OpenAI's March 2026 shutdown of Sora, as reported by AP News, highlighted growing concerns about deepfake proliferation. This event triggered widespread platform reforms, including the Content Authenticity Initiative adopted by all major generators. The standards mandate visible AI disclosure watermarks and content provenance metadata in all exports.

Copyright systems have also evolved in response. AI Inspo's May 2026 update introduced automatic music licensing checks, while Revid AI now verifies all third-party visual elements against a rights database. These measures aim to prevent the viral spread of unauthorized content while maintaining creative flexibility.

Perhaps most significantly, platforms are developing "ethical virality" algorithms that deprioritize harmful or misleading content. World Cup AI Templates employ sentiment analysis to flag potentially inflammatory sports rivalry content, while TrendFusion AI rejects templates that could facilitate misinformation campaigns. These safeguards attempt to balance creative freedom with social responsibility.
